Key Insights

The Electric Vehicle (EV) testing services market is experiencing robust growth, driven by the accelerating global adoption of electric vehicles. The increasing demand for EVs necessitates rigorous testing to ensure safety, performance, and regulatory compliance. This market, estimated at $10 billion in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 15% from 2025 to 2033, reaching approximately $30 billion by 2033. Key growth drivers include stringent government regulations mandating thorough EV testing, the rising consumer demand for EVs, and continuous technological advancements in battery technology and charging infrastructure. The market is segmented by testing type (EMC, electrical safety, conformance and interoperability, and others) and application (battery, charging pile, vehicle body, and others), offering diverse testing services to various EV components. Major players like Intertek, UL, DEKRA, TÜV Group, and Bureau Veritas dominate the market, leveraging their established expertise and global presence. Regional variations exist, with North America and Europe currently holding significant market share due to early EV adoption and robust regulatory frameworks. However, the Asia-Pacific region is projected to witness the fastest growth due to increasing EV manufacturing and sales in countries like China and India. The market faces challenges such as the high cost of testing and the need for specialized expertise, but these are mitigated by ongoing technological advancements and increased investment in the sector.

Driving Forces: What's Propelling the Electric Vehicle Testing Service Market?

Several key factors are propelling the growth of the electric vehicle testing service market. Firstly, the accelerating global transition towards electric mobility is creating an unprecedented demand for rigorous testing to ensure the safety, reliability, and performance of EVs. Governments worldwide are implementing stringent regulations and standards for EV safety and emissions, making compliance testing a crucial necessity for EV manufacturers. The inherent complexity of EV technology, involving sophisticated battery systems, power electronics, and advanced driver-assistance systems (ADAS), necessitates comprehensive testing to identify and mitigate potential risks. Furthermore, the increasing consumer focus on EV safety and reliability is driving the demand for thorough testing and certification. Consumers are increasingly demanding assurance that their EVs meet high safety and performance standards, leading manufacturers to prioritize rigorous testing. Finally, the continuous innovation in EV technology requires ongoing testing to validate new features and components. The rapid pace of technological advancements in battery technology, charging infrastructure, and autonomous driving systems necessitates a constant evolution of testing methodologies and capabilities. This ongoing need for testing and validation is a major driver of market growth. The increasing investment in R&D by both EV manufacturers and testing service providers is further accelerating the market's expansion.

Challenges and Restraints in Electric Vehicle Testing Service Market

Despite the significant growth opportunities, the electric vehicle testing service market faces several challenges. The high cost of setting up and maintaining advanced testing facilities and acquiring specialized equipment can present a substantial barrier to entry for smaller players. The need for highly skilled personnel with expertise in various aspects of EV technology poses a challenge in terms of talent acquisition and retention. Keeping abreast of the rapidly evolving standards and regulations related to EV safety and performance requires significant investments in research and development, which can be financially demanding. Competition is intense, with a diverse range of established players and emerging companies vying for market share. Moreover, the geographic distribution of testing facilities might be uneven, potentially leading to difficulties in accessing testing services for some manufacturers, especially in developing economies. Standardization challenges also exist, as various regions might have different regulatory requirements and testing protocols, which necessitate adapting testing methodologies to different markets. Finally, the evolving nature of EV technology and the emergence of new vehicle architectures (such as solid-state batteries) continuously necessitates the updating of testing procedures and infrastructure, adding another layer of complexity and cost.

Key Region or Country & Segment to Dominate the Market

The Battery segment is poised to dominate the EV testing service market due to the critical role of batteries in EV performance and safety. Battery testing encompasses various aspects, including cell testing, module testing, pack testing, and system-level testing. These tests are crucial for ensuring the safety, longevity, and performance of the battery, which is a critical component of EVs.

  • North America and Europe are projected to lead the market due to the high adoption rate of EVs, stringent regulatory frameworks, and a well-established automotive testing infrastructure. The substantial investments by governments and private entities in promoting EV adoption in these regions are further driving the market's growth. These regions also boast a highly developed ecosystem of testing service providers with extensive experience and technological expertise.

  • Asia-Pacific, particularly China, is also showing significant growth, fueled by rapid EV adoption and ambitious government targets for electric vehicle penetration. While the testing infrastructure may still be developing compared to North America and Europe, the enormous market size and potential in this region present lucrative opportunities for testing service providers.

The Battery segment's dominance stems from the numerous tests required to ascertain battery performance under varying conditions. These include:

  • Endurance testing: Evaluating the battery's ability to withstand repeated charge-discharge cycles over its lifetime.
  • Thermal testing: Assessing the battery's performance under extreme temperatures.
  • Safety testing: Evaluating the battery's resilience to short circuits, overcharging, and other potential hazards.
  • Fast-charging testing: Assessing the battery's ability to withstand rapid charging.

The complexity of these tests, and the stringent regulatory requirements surrounding battery safety, drives the significant demand within this segment. The continued advancement of battery technologies, including the emergence of solid-state batteries, will further fuel growth in this area. The high value of battery systems within an EV also elevates the importance of rigorous testing to ensure both safety and performance. This, in conjunction with the strong presence of EV manufacturing and a supportive regulatory environment in North America, Europe, and increasingly Asia-Pacific, solidifies the Battery segment's leading position within the EV testing service market.
